Permanent vs Rolloff dumpsters
Whether or not you need a long-term or roll-off dumpster depends upon the kind of job and service you will need. Long-Lasting dumpster service is for continuous demands that last longer than just a couple of days. This includes things like day to day waste and recycling needs. Temporary service is exactly what the name implies; a one time need for project-special waste removal.
Temporary roll-off dumpsters are delivered on a truck and are rolled off where they will be utilized. All these are usually bigger containers that could handle all the waste which is included with that special job. Long-Lasting dumpsters are usually smaller containers because they are emptied on a regular basis and so do not need to hold as much at one time.
Should you request a long-term dumpster, some companies demand at least a one-year service agreement for this dumpster. Rolloff dumpsters merely need a rental fee for the time that you simply maintain the dumpster on the job.
Dumpster Sizes Explained
When comparing dumpster sizes to find one that meets your project's needs, it is vital that you understand how rental companies measure dimensions.
Nearly all roll of dumpsters have exactly the same width (generally eight feet). That makes it feasible for firms to utilize the same trucks to transport a wide selection of dumpsters. When you see a dumpster's measurements, Thus , you can presume that they refer to depth and span. You may also see dumpster sizes listed by yards. This actually refers to square yards that measure the dumpster's volume.
What Size Do You Need?In the event you're organizing a sizable commercial job, then you'll likely need a 40-yard dumpster or larger. Big house renovations may require a 30-yard dumpster, but most smaller house repairs just want 20-yard or even 10-yard dumpsters. Speak to an expert if you want more guidance on deciding on a dumpster size that fits your endeavor.

Security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ster
Follow these recommendations to stay safe while using a rental dumpster.
1. Participate the rear w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a small incline could induce it to roll.
2. Do not overfill the dumpster. Things shouldn't stick out of the top opening.
3. Use caution when opening the dumpster door, and be sure to lock it when you're done.
4. Wear safety gloves to protect your hands while loading debris.
5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y things to the dumpster.
6. Simply let grownups close to the dumpster.
7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. Once they enter the landfill, they could leak out and contaminate your local ground water.
8. Be sure you have lots of lighting when transferring debris to the dumpster. If your plan is to work at twilight, get a light that provides enough illumination.

Determining Where to Place Your Dumpster
Determining where to place your dumpster can have a large effect on how fast you finish projects. The most effective alternative is to choose a place that is close to the worksite. It is important, however, to consider whether this place is a safe alternative. Make sure the area is free of obstructions that could trip folks while they take heavy debris.
Lots of folks decide to set dumpsters in their driveways. This really is a convenient alternative because it usually means you can avoid asking the city for a license or permit. In case you have to set the dumpster on the street, then you should get in touch with your local government to ask whether you have to get a permit. Although a lot of municipalities will let folks keep dumpsters on the road for short levels of time, others are going to ask you to complete some paperwork. Following these rules will help you stay away from fines that'll make your project more expensive.
